## Band of Brothers: Inspiring Legacy and Valor
When you hear the term “band of brothers,” it’s hard not to feel a rush of emotion. This phrase isn’t just about camaraderie; it’s a legendary testament to loyalty and sacrifice that transcends time and context. Originally from Shakespeare’s play “Henry V,” it gained new life as a symbol of military brotherhood through the acclaimed HBO miniseries “Band of Brothers.” This show brought to light the real-life experiences of Easy Company during World War II, making it a cultural touchstone for those who value loyalty.

The story of the Chicago Cubs’ 2016 World Series victory serves as a prime example of how sports can illustrate the “band of brothers” concept. The tight-knit groups of players forged immense trust, which ultimately propelled them to break a 108-year championship drought. This victory wasn’t just about winning; it showed the world what can happen when individuals commit to a shared goal, relying on one another through thick and thin.
Organizations like Team Rubicon leverage the skills and bonds formed by veterans during their service to assist in disaster recovery efforts across the globe. By uniting veterans for a common purpose, they not only honor their past but also continue the legacy of brotherhood. This illustrates the profound ways in which military connections can translate into meaningful community service.
